Living with Diabetes is an authoritative, yet easy-to-understand guide to the causes and types of diabetes, the risk factors and symptoms, and how to manage the condition day-to-day written in conjunction with the Canadian Diabetes Association.
The guide includes advice on diet, exercise and controlling blood glucose levels, together with information about the glycaemic index of various foods and covers all types of diabetes, and includes the special concerns of diabetes in children and teenagers. Clear step-by-step photographs illustrate key procedures such as injecting insulin.
Reader-friendly and truly empowering, Living With Diabetes: A Practical Guide to Managing Your Health is an essential reference for people living with one of the world's fastest growing medical problems.
